Description

Ethyl 4-oxobutanoate is a carboxylic ester obtained by the formal condensation of the carboxy group of succinic semialdehyde with ethanol. It has a role as a metabolite. It is an aldehyde and a carboxylic ester. It derives from a succinic semialdehyde and an ethanol.
